Present Tense (literally)
And I did!!! (hence the pictures on previous posts)
However, I didn't know what I was in for.
20 minutes of dry detangling
1 Hour to wash or Co-Wash
4-6 Hours of Conditioning and detangling
1-2 Hours of styling
Overnight or more to dry...

Its getting to be way too much for me!!!
I am sooooooooo low maintenance it's not even funny. And for me, what I just described is out of control!


On Second Hand!

I have to admit that after all of that work that I put in, it is very encouraging to see the end results and to receive all of the compliments on my dooo. But for all of that work, the dooo only last 3-4 days tops...and that is if I am pushing it! There is no changing it up or going to a "easy style" for the day...its a whole ordeal just to make a easy style...
